Finding the Perfect Bedrock Server
To find the perfect Bedrock server, consider the following steps:
Research and Recommendations: Start by researching reputable Minecraft server lists, forums, or Bedrock-specific communities that provide server recommendations. Seek feedback and recommendations from other players who have experience with Bedrock servers.
Server Population and Activity: Look for servers with a healthy population and active community. A thriving player base indicates an engaged and vibrant server environment. Check for recent activity, online player counts, and updates to ensure the server is active and well-maintained.
Server Themes and Gameplay: Consider the server's themes and gameplay options. Some servers may focus on creative building, while others may offer unique game modes like survival challenges or mini-games. Choose a server that aligns with your interests and preferences to ensure an enjoyable experience.
Server Rules and Community Guidelines: Familiarize yourself with the server's rules and community guidelines. Ensure that they align with your gameplay preferences and expectations. Look for servers that promote a friendly and inclusive atmosphere and discourage griefing or disruptive behavior.
Server Stability and Uptime: Check for server stability and uptime to ensure a smooth and uninterrupted gameplay experience. A well-maintained server with regular updates and reliable hosting ensures a stable connection and minimizes the risk of downtime.
Joining a Bedrock Server
To join a Bedrock server, follow these steps:
Launch Minecraft Bedrock Edition: Ensure you have the Bedrock Edition of Minecraft installed on your preferred platform.
Server Discovery: Explore server lists, forums, or dedicated Bedrock server websites to discover servers that catch your interest. Note down the server IP address or domain name.
Add Server: Launch Minecraft Bedrock Edition and navigate to the "Servers" tab. Click "Add Server" and enter the server IP address or domain name. Save the server to your list.
Join the Server: Select the server from your list and click "Join Server" to connect. Follow any prompts or instructions provided by the server to complete the connection process.
